Understanding peak garage sale seasons also enhances your discovery strategy. Spring and early summer months typically generate the highest concentration of sales, while fall presents secondary opportunities. Weekend mornings, particularly Saturday and Sunday between 7 AM and 12 PM, represent the prime shopping windows when inventory remains most abundant and seller enthusiasm peaks.

Strategic Shopping Tips for Maximum Savings
Effective garage sale shopping requires strategic planning that extends beyond simple discovery. Successful shoppers develop systematic approaches to evaluation, negotiation, and purchasing that maximize value extraction from limited inventory and variable pricing structures.
Arriving early provides significant competitive advantages, particularly for sought-after items that multiple buyers covet. Early arrival ensures access to complete inventory before selective purchasing diminishes selection. However, understanding individual seller schedules and start times prevents wasted trips; many sellers begin setup processes before official start times, creating opportunities for early-bird negotiations.
Creating a prioritized shopping list based on specific needs rather than impulse purchasing dramatically improves value realization. Identifying particular items, brands, or categories you actively seek prevents distraction by novelty items that consume budget without addressing genuine needs. This disciplined approach extends your purchasing power across multiple sales rather than concentrating spending on single locations.
Developing proficiency in negotiation strategies significantly impacts final prices paid. Understanding that garage sale pricing often includes built-in negotiation margin enables confident discussions about bundle pricing, multiple-item discounts, and end-of-sale reductions. Many sellers price items expecting negotiation and appreciate serious buyers willing to engage in respectful price discussions.
Timing end-of-sale visits strategically yields exceptional discounts as sellers prioritize inventory clearance over maximizing individual item prices. Arriving in final hours often enables bulk purchasing at significantly reduced rates, particularly for lower-priority items sellers wish to eliminate. This end-of-day strategy works especially well for sellers planning disposal of unsold merchandise.
Building relationships with repeat sellers creates long-term advantages similar to B2B sales relationships. Reliable buyers who demonstrate respect for merchandise and fair negotiation practices often receive advance notifications about upcoming sales and preferential access to premium inventory before public advertising.
Cash payment remains the standard garage sale currency, providing psychological advantages in negotiations while eliminating processing delays. Carrying appropriate denominations prevents overpaying due to unavailable change while demonstrating serious purchasing intent to sellers.
Evaluating Quality and Authenticity
Distinguishing genuine quality from cosmetic appeal represents a critical skill in garage sale shopping. Items priced attractively may carry hidden defects or functional limitations that require expensive repairs, ultimately negating savings achieved through low purchase prices.
Developing systematic inspection protocols ensures consistent evaluation across different sale visits. Testing electronics functionality, examining furniture structural integrity, assessing clothing condition for stains or damage, and verifying completeness of items with multiple components prevents costly post-purchase disappointments. Many successful garage sale shoppers carry inspection tools like flashlights, magnifying glasses, and charging cables to thoroughly evaluate items before committing to purchases.
Understanding brand reputation and product longevity helps identify items offering superior long-term value despite higher initial garage sale prices. Quality manufacturers known for durability and repairability often justify premium pricing compared to disposable alternatives. Researching recent retail prices for items under consideration provides valuable context for evaluating garage sale pricing. Mobile price comparison apps enable real-time research that identifies exceptional bargains versus moderately discounted items. Understanding current market values prevents overpaying relative to alternative retail options.
Assessing authenticity for collectible items, vintage merchandise, and branded products requires specialized knowledge or willingness to research before purchasing. Counterfeit merchandise occasionally appears in garage sales, particularly for luxury brands and sought-after collectibles. Verifying authenticity through detailed examination, serial number verification, and consultation with specialist resources prevents costly authentication errors post-purchase.
Evaluating seller credibility through previous feedback, transparency about item condition, and willingness to answer detailed questions helps predict transaction quality. Trustworthy sellers typically provide honest descriptions of defects, acknowledge limitations, and demonstrate genuine interest in customer satisfaction beyond immediate transaction completion.

What should I bring when shopping garage sales?
Experienced shoppers carry cash in multiple denominations, reusable shopping bags, flashlights for interior merchandise examination, measuring tape for furniture, phone chargers or portable batteries, and price comparison apps for research. Comfortable walking shoes, weather-appropriate clothing, and hand sanitizer address physical comfort and hygiene considerations during extended shopping sessions.
How do I negotiate prices at garage sales effectively?
Respectful negotiation begins with understanding that garage sale pricing typically includes negotiation margin. Offering 10-20% below asking prices for individual items, proposing bundle discounts for multiple purchases, and engaging in friendly conversation establishes collaborative negotiation tone. Arriving during end-of-sale periods creates natural negotiation opportunities as sellers prioritize inventory clearance.
